What to do when a reasoned and intelligent person - Professor Girin is forced to give a test of foreign literature to a careless student Kolobkova, who for him is only a plague of God. She has never read Hamlet in her life and usually falls asleep on the 7th page of any literary work.
For him, it is a nullity and a daddy's girl. For her, he's a boring man, a man with two functions: reading and questioning. However, over time, the phrase “until new exciting meetings,” which Jirin told the stupid youngster after another “failure,” takes on a whole different meaning.
